ABOUT THE COMPANY – ISFAP

The Ikusasa Student Financial Aid Programme (ISFAP) was formed with the aim of financially assisting poor and middle-income university students to afford their tertiary fees. Contributions are received from donors within the private and public sector – Woolworths, Liberty, Coronation, Discovery, Hollard, Sanlam, Sasol, Sappi, Mondi, Nedbank, Standard Bank and Volkswagen to name a few.

MORE ABOUT THE ISFAP BURSARY PROGRAMME – COVERAGE VALUE

The bursary will provide cover for the following expenses: tuition fees, books, study materials, accommodation, meals and a monthly stipend.

Bursary recipients will also receive the following support: social support, life skills training, academic support (including extended programmes; academic development and tutorials), mentoring for the first year, medical support, tracking of academic performance via the online student platform and access to dedicated programme managers.
 

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S FOR THE ISFAP BURSARY

Applicants must satisfy the following minimum entry criteria before applying (please note that failure to satisfy all the requirements will lead to your application not being considered):

  • You must be a South African citizen
  • You must have completed Matric
  • You must be registered to study towards one of the aforementioned qualifications (undergraduate studies only)
  • You must be registered to study at one of the following tertiary institutions for the 2022 academic year: University of Johannesburg, University of Pretoria, University of the Witwatersrand, University of Cape Town, Stellenbosch University, University of KwaZulu-Natal, Nelson Mandela University, Walter Sisulu University, University of Venda, Tshwane University of Technology or Central University of Technology
  • You must be starting your first degree in the 2022 academic year
  • You must have a family household income NOT more than R600 000 per annum
  • You must be in financial need and require funding for your studies
  • You must NOT be in receipt of any other study funding (including NSFAS)

HOW TO APPLY FOR THE ISFAP BURSARY

Applications must be done online at: ISFAP Bursary Application 2022
 

Students who pass the bursary “pre-application” stage, will receive an email requesting them to submit their supporting documentation. Candidates should have the following supporting documentation ready for submission (the submission of these documents is compulsory – if any items are missing, your application may be disqualified):

  • Personal information (name, surname, email address and contact number)
  • ID document (certified copy)
  • Matric certificate or Matric latest results (certified copy)
  • Proof of registration at one of these above institutions for 2022 (on tertiary letterhead)
  • Proof of household proof of income (latest payslips if employed, affidavit if unemployed, proof of any grants or pension if applicable)
  • Confirmation that you are not in receipt of any other funding for the 2022 academic year
